Facts about Kidney Donation: Living donation does not change life expectancy and does not appear to increase the risk of kidney failure.  https://www.kidney.org/transplantation/livingdonors/what-expect-after-donation#:~:text=Living%20donation%20does%20not%20change,the%20risks%20involved%20in%20donation. After one kidney is removed for donation, the remaining kidney undergoes a process known as “Compensatory Hypertrophy” i.e., it increases in size and takes over the function of the other kidney as well. The donor leads a normal life after donation. https://www.narayanahealth.org/blog/all-you-need-to-know-about-life-after-a-kidney-transplant/amp/ The more you know!
